Tegucigalpa is the capital of Honduras and the country's largest city, tucked among green mountains. It is where the government works and where many important museums and old churches sit.
You can wander the colorful old town, visit the big Cathedral of Saint Michael, and ride up to Picacho Park to see a huge statue of Christ and a small zoo. The city's up-and-down streets feel like a fun maze.
The historic center has cobbled streets, painted houses, and the pretty white cathedral where families gather in the main plaza.
La Tigra cloud forest sits just outside the city, full of tall trees, birds, and cool misty trails to explore.
